PSP games were notable for their ambition and creativity. Titles such as God of War: Chains of Olympus, Metal Gear Solid: Peace Walker, and Crisis Core: Final Fantasy VII offered cinematic storytelling, complex mechanics, and expansive worlds. Unlike many handheld games of the era, these titles were full-fledged experiences, proving that the best games were not confined to large consoles.
Beyond popular franchises, the PSP introduced original games that became iconic. Patapon, LocoRoco, and Daxter combined unique gameplay styles with rhythm, strategy, and creativity. These PSP games reflected Sony’s commitment to innovation, offering distinct experiences that players could not find anywhere else and contributing to the handheld’s enduring legacy.
Multiplayer gameplay added another dimension to PSP gaming. Monster Hunter Freedom Unite and Resistance: Retribution allowed players to connect through ad-hoc networks, fostering cooperation or competition in thrilling missions. These social features enhanced the appeal of PSP games, demonstrating the platform’s versatility and contributing to its recognition among the best games for portable systems.
The PSP also functioned as a multifunctional device, capable of playing music, videos, and accessing the internet. This versatility made it appealing beyond gaming audiences, helping to introduce a wider demographic to PSP games and solidifying the device’s position as an innovative entertainment platform.
